Q: Is 21,041,241 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 21,041,241 is a composite number.

Why is 21,041,241 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 21,041,241 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 41 123 533 1,599 13,159 39,477 171,067 513,201 539,519 1,618,557 7,013,747 and 21,041,241, with no remainder.

Since 21,041,241 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,041,241, it is a composite number.
